8Bitdo Unresponsive with charge light stuck on

If you haven’t heard of 8Bitdo check them out. They have an amazing line of wireless controllers. I personally love my SN30 Pro.

The other day I wanted to play some Cuphead and to my dismay the controller wasn’t responding. When I disconnected the USB cable (as I was charging it and using ti at the same time just recently prior) the charge light remained lit.

baffled I tried looking in the manual, and trying different button combinations and holds, after all this failed I googled which lead me to this reddit form

To my amazement the reply by “Tamoketh”

“The orange light stayed on?

Hold the Start button until the orange light turns off. Then turn on as normal.”

actually worked, I don’t know why this wasn’t written in the user manual, considering it has no direct power button.
